Bridging Bionics Foundation

Organization Overview

Bridging Bionics Foundation is located in Basalt, CO. The organization was established in 2014. According to its NTEE Classification (O50) the organization is classified as: Youth Development Programs, under the broad grouping of Youth Development and related organizations. As of 12/2021, Bridging Bionics Foundation employed 2 individuals.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Bridging Bionics Foundation is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.

For the year ending 12/2021, Bridging Bionics Foundation generated $654.2k in total revenue. This organization has experienced exceptional growth, as over the past 7 years, it has increased revenue by an average of 10.7% each year . All expenses for the organization totaled $636.8k during the year ending 12/2021.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.

Describe the Organization's Mission:

Part 3 - Line 1

EDUCATE PATIENTS ABOUT ROBOTIC "EXO-SKELETONS" & PROVIDE INSTRUCTION FOR USE FOR DISABLED PERSONS; PROVIDE PHYSICAL THERAPY SERVICES TO PATIENTS TO USE EXOSKELETONS; ASSIST DISABLED PATIENTS.

Describe the Organization's Program Activity:

Part 3 - Line 4a

BRIDGING BIONICS PROVIDES EQUIPMENT AND CONTRACTS WITH PHYSICAL THERAPISTS TO PROVIDE MOBILITY THERAPY TO PATIENTS WITH SPINAL CORD INJURIES, SUCH AS EXOSKELETON THERAPY FOR PARALYZED PATIENTS; PROVIDE ACCESS TO CUTTING EDGE TECHNOLOGY WHICH IS COST PROHIBITIVE FOR INDIVIDUALS IN THE ROARING FORK VALLEY WITH NEUROLOGICAL MOBILITY IMPAREMENTS; REDUCE SECONDARY COMPLICATIONS AS A CONSEQUENCE OF PARALYSIS AND TO SERVE AS PREVENTATIVE HEALTHCARE MEASURE AND TO ENHANCE NEURO RECOVERY.


ADMINISTRATIVE FUNDRAISING CAMPAIGNS FOR INDIVIDUALS WHO MEET THE CRITERIA TO ACQUIRE GALILEO NEUROLOGICAL TECHNOLOGIES OR EXO SKELETONS.
